What is a product?
A product is one thing you sell, such as a walking tour, a boat trip or a three-night stay. Here is what every product is made of.
Voyant Support
A product is one thing you sell. A morning walking tour is a product. A sunset cruise is a product. Three nights at a guesthouse is a product.
Everything customers can buy from you starts life as a product.
What every product is made of
No matter what you sell, a product holds the same four things.
- The description. The name, the summary, what is included, what is not, and your terms.
- The shape. How customers pick a date, and how many people you can take. See Booking modes.
- The prices. What each kind of traveler pays, plus any extras.
- The dates. The specific departures customers can actually book.
A tour and a hotel stay use the same four things. They just fill them in differently.
Where products live
Click Products in the left menu. That is the list of everything you sell.
Each row shows you the essentials at a glance: the name, whether it is on sale, the price it starts from, and how customers pick a date.
